Colorado’s Peak One Surgery Center Provides Free Surgery for Uninsured, Receives National Attention

Peak One Surgery Center in Frisco, Colo., provided free surgery to 13 uninsured patients on June 12, according to multiple news reports.

Advertisement

The story was picked up by CNN, according to Pinnacle III, which has managed the ASC since the facility’s inception in 2005.

Seven physicians and the ASC’s staff volunteered on the Saturday and performed procedures including knee surgery and a hysterectomy.

Patients were chosen based on income and the beneficial impact of the surgery.
